Frequently Asked Questions about Escondido
How much are Studio apartments in Escondido?
There are currently 151 Studio Apartments in Escondido with rent ranges from $1,364 to $3,714 with an average price of $2,212.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Escondido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Escondido ranges from $1,464 to $5,168 with an average monthly rent of $2,673.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Escondido c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Escondido range from $1,740 to $10,331.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,465.
How expensive are Escondido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 122 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Escondido on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$2,419 to $12,909 - averaging $5,185 for the location.
